Transaction 6219f949bd6faccd49a214a1caa62ccbd41165be4a54f75105394aafbecfa408

1 Input
2 Outputs
  • 6219f949bd6faccd49a214a1caa62ccbd41165be4a54f75105394aafbecfa408:0
  • value  10000000
    address  3BUrxrkCdbymhQFadYd5ytRLw7JSB4VuDK
  • 6219f949bd6faccd49a214a1caa62ccbd41165be4a54f75105394aafbecfa408:1
  • value  24335492
    address  13xVpcJycS34DwsEPego8QZj8UPH4uzp4e